Block

#21,766,414
Block Number
21,766,414 @ 05/25/2025, 17:15:50
Status
Finalized
ID
0x014c210e756064854842b511cdbf947053b08255e64da2bca78a0dc23901ef35
Transactions
Gas Used
4028387/40000000 (10.07% Used)
Total Score
2,125,770,340 (+98)
Rewards
14.90 VTHO